Adding a Level to 441 Spruce Ave,
Garwood NJ
Now under construction,
the Daunno's are working for newly appointed
Garwood Councilman Jonathan Linken and his wife
Heather. Using a plan drawn by one of Daunno's
Civil Engineers and certified by Roger Winkle,
we will be tearing the roof off their current
ranch and adding four bedrooms, 2 bathrooms, and
a laundry room to the second floor of their
home. When complete, the home will also have a
new roof and new
siding. |
Expanding 54 Lee Drive with 2
Additions,
Livingston NJ With this home, Daunno will be
building 2 rear additions to maximize living
space. Using a design by Architect Thomas K.
Hoffman, the additions will eventually provide
the homeowners with a beautiful family room and
spacious breakfast nook intended to optimize
homeowner enjoyment. Stay tuned for updates as
construction will begin
shortly.

Demolition Begins at
Forest Glen Estates
On March 12th, the
Daunno's began the demolition at Forest Glen Estates.
Upon completion of demo, they also moved forward with
the projects site work. This includes both sanitary
and storm sewers as well as roads and under ground
utilities.
This will definately be a project
worth watching as more plans unfold.
